Tucked away in a peaceful residential setting and backing directly onto the open spaces of Greenleas Recreation Ground, this exceptional extended three-bedroom bungalow offers luxurious single-level living on a generous, level plot. Boasting a superb west-facing garden and extensive off-street parking, this is a rare opportunity in a sought-after part of Hangleton.
Set behind a gravelled driveway providing parking for several vehicles, the property is beautifully presented throughout and arranged across one expansive level. Upon entering, you’re welcomed by a spacious L-shaped hallway leading to three generous double bedrooms and a contemporary, high-end bathroom.
The large living room provides a relaxing retreat, ideal for lazy afternoons or cosy evenings, and flows seamlessly into the open-plan kitchen and dining area. This modern and stylish space is bathed in natural light thanks to two large skylights and wide bi-folding doors that lead directly onto the garden. The kitchen is a true focal point, complete with sleek cabinetry, integrated appliances, stylish worktops, and a central island with a gas hob — perfect for social gatherings or a casual breakfast.
The west-facing rear garden is a true delight. A beautifully designed paved terrace leads directly from the kitchen and is ideal for alfresco dining. The low-maintenance artificial lawn is perfect for children’s play, while a wooden summer house at the rear offers versatile use as a home office, gym or garden room. You’ll also find gated side access.
There is also excellent potential to further extend into the loft space (subject to the necessary consents), making this home a perfect long-term investment.
Location
Hangleton is one of Brighton & Hove’s best-kept secrets — a well-connected and family-friendly neighbourhood known for its wide roads, great schools, and excellent access to both the city centre and the A27/A23.
You’re just a short walk from two fantastic parks — Greenleas and St Helen’s Green — where you’ll find everything from outdoor fitness classes and football games to children’s playgrounds.
The area is renowned for its schooling options, with highly regarded primary schools including Hangleton, Kings, and West Blatchington nearby, while older children are served by the popular Blatchington Mill and Hove Park secondary schools.
For commuters, both Portslade and Hove railway stations are within easy reach, offering direct routes into London in under an hour.
